PURPOSE:To check reverse ionization and improve the efficiency of trapping particles with the sequential zigzag arrangement in the air current of a front stage grooved electrode train opened in the direction equal to the air current and a rear stage grooved electrode train opened in two directions, equal and opposite to the air current. CONSTITUTION:Trains of shevron-like grooved electrodes 1 and 4 and X-cross- sectioned grooved electrodes 2 and 3 are arranged to cross the air current. The first train 1 is opened in the direction equal to the air current as indicated by the arrow and the second and third train are opened in the direction respectively opposite and equal to the air current. In addition, with the respective electrodes zigzaged, a discharge projection 6 is provided at the electrode open end between the first and third trains to form a discharge pole 5 while a bar-shaped member 8 is provided at the electrode open end between the second and fourth trains to form a trapping pole 7. With such an arrangement, it is possible to eliminate the re-dispersion of particles in the high speed current, thereby assuring high efficient trapping of particles high in electric resistance without causing reverse ionization. |
